The Town of Nolensville, TN, (approx. pop. 16,836) is seeking an experienced human resource professional to serve as its next Human Resources Director. The Human Resources Director reports directly to the Town Manager and performs professional work in a variety of human resource-related tasks in the functional areas of recruitment, selection and retention, management practices, employment law compliance, compensation and benefits administration, training and development, employee relations, and risk management.
The candidate will possess a bachelor’s degree in human resource management, industrial/organizational psychology, or related field, preferably. A master’s degree in human resource management or industrial/organizational psychology desired. The candidate should have five (5) or more years of progressively responsible experience in professional, exempt level, human resource work, preferably in local government, or any combination of education, training, certification, and experience providing the necessary knowledge, skills, and abilities to successfully perform the essential job functions. PHR or SPHR and/or SHRM-CP or SHRM-SCP certification(s) strongly preferred. Valid driver’s license required. The salary for this at-will position will be commensurate with the candidate’s education and experience. Residency in the Town of Nolensville is not required.
